Back on the Blog

So...not only am I signed up to do the same half marathon as last year (Vermont City - a great race), but in an insane moment, I thought it might be "fun" to participate in the 100 on 100 Relay. That's 100 miles on Vermont Route 100. It's a six-person relay, but still -- each person winds up running about 16 miles in three separate legs.

This motivated me enough to start speed training today - I did four quarter-mile repeats and it actually wasn't too bad, in spite of the fact that I've had a cough for the past six weeks.

one-mile warm-up: 11:32
2:31
2:27
2:28
2:18 (no idea why this one was so much faster)
and a half-mile cool down.

This is not significantly slower than March 2008 - plus, I have the treadmill at a 0.5 incline now, to try to better simulate "real" conditions. Even though it really doesn't. Still, it is encouraging to think I might not be starting over completely!

I have only 14 weeks until the half, so I'd better get a move on. Time to seek out a training program and try to stick with it!
